Default Charging problems?

Why is it that when the gauge cluster is unpluged the alternator does not recharge the battery? This is the second f-body that i have owned that has done this. I am installing all aftermarket gauges so the factory cluster is not plugged in. Does anyone know how to bypass whatever it is that is causing this?

the single wire from the alt goes to the cluster, its one of those things that GM did to help keep people from pulling the clusters and driving them. just hook the wire on the alt to a switched power source.

on my 93 the wire leads right into the cluster I pulled the wire out of C220 on mine and ran it to a switched source off the key.
